keen in English

adjective
1
having or showing eagerness or enthusiasm.
keen believers in the monetary system
verb
1
wail in grief for a dead person; sing a keen.
She could hear voices speaking in soothing tones, but Anna keened and wailed, and Kathleen tried not to imagine the scene on the other side of the door.
noun
1
an Irish funeral song accompanied by wailing in lamentation for the dead.
